Хостинг серверов Minecraft playvds.com
  1. Вы находитесь в русском сообществе Buk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на русский язык плагины наших собратьев из других стран.
    Скрыть объявление
  2. Данный раздел создан исключительно для релизов! Вопросы по лаунчеру или обвязке задавайте ТОЛЬКО в соответсвующей теме автора. Любые другие темы будут удалены, а авторы понесут наказание.

Веб webMCR 2.4

Тема в разделе "Веб-обвязки и лаунчеры", создана пользователем NC22, 30 авг 2012.

  1. Alastar

    Alastar Старожил Пользователь

    Баллы:
    173
    Под админом заходишь, и сверху, в панели, появляется кнопка "Добавить новость"
     
  2. Хостинг MineCraft
    <
  3. TheTurtale

    TheTurtale Активный участник

    Баллы:
    63
    Имя в Minecraft:
    TheTurtale
    А по точнее можно?
     
    Сникерсни нравится это.
  4. Alastar

    Alastar Старожил Пользователь

    Баллы:
    173
  5. Alastar

    Alastar Старожил Пользователь

    Баллы:
    173
    Скрин в студию
     
  6. TheTurtale

    TheTurtale Активный участник

    Баллы:
    63
    Имя в Minecraft:
    TheTurtale
    Alastar спасибо всё сделал всё понял!
     
  7. PohmeloO

    PohmeloO Активный участник

    Баллы:
    68
    Имя в Minecraft:
    PohmeloO
    Что бы без вопросов по поводу оформления сайта:
    Наслаждаемся и не задаем вопросов+ Музычка вообще огонь:trf:
     
    Alastar и PacMyc нравится это.
  8. PacMyc

    PacMyc Активный участник Пользователь

    Баллы:
    68
    Skype:
    pacmyc.ru
    "Лого" конечно меняется в docs.css, но твой вариант будет проще для тех, кто даже в html разобраться не может. Лайк поставил.
     
  9. PohmeloO

    PohmeloO Активный участник

    Баллы:
    68
    Имя в Minecraft:
    PohmeloO
    @PacMyc, так я и делал самый легкий способ на мое усмотрение) для себя я полностью все переписал а с WebMCR забрал только скрипты.
     
  10. PacMyc

    PacMyc Активный участник Пользователь

    Баллы:
    68
    Skype:
    pacmyc.ru
    Мини урок для тех кто хочет добавить свои кнопки в меню и страницы на сайте.


    1. Делаем копию файла menu.html в папки style и переименовываем его в menu-not-logged.html. Редактируем menu-not-logged.html под себя. В моем примере будут две дополнительные кнопки:
    Код:
    <li id="menu-main-btn"><a href="index.php">Главная</a></li>
    <li id="menu-start-btn"><a href="index.php?mode=100">Начать играть</a></li>
    <li id="menu-info-btn"><a href="index.php?mode=101">Информация</a></li>
    Обратите внимание на параметр id="" и ?mode=, идентификатор с номером должны быть уникальными.

    2. Редактируем файл index.php. Находим строчку (40):
    Код:
    if ($mode!=2 and $mode!=55 and $mode != 22 and $mode != 'news_full')
    Добавляем в нее наши страницы, т.е. mode=100 и mode=101. Получается:
    Код:
    if ($mode!=2 and $mode!=55 and $mode != 22 and $mode!=100 and $mode!=101 and $mode != 'news_full')
    Далее находим строчку (56):
    Код:
    if (empty($user)) $menu = '<li id="menu-main-btn" class="active"><a href="index.php">Главная</a></li>';
    Заменяем ее полностью на:
    Код:
    if (empty($user)) {
     
    ob_start();
    include $way_style.'menu-not-logged.html';
    $menu = ob_get_clean();
     
    }    
    Находим строчку (133):
    Код:
        if ($mode==55) { ob_start(); include $way_style.'start-game.html'; $content_right = ob_get_clean(); }
    Вставляем после нее нашу первую кнопку:
    Код:
     elseif ($mode==100) {
     
        ob_start();
     
        $page = 'Начать играть';
        include $way_style.'start-game.html'; $content_right = ob_get_clean();
        $addition_events .= "document.getElementById('menu-start-btn').setAttribute('class', 'active');";
        }
    Тут есть три момента.
    1. ($mode==100) это номер нашей странице в menu-not-logged.html
    2. start-game.html это сама страница, а точнее ее содержание. Должна находиться в папки style.
    3. menu-start-btn это уникальный идентификатор в menu-not-logged.html
    Таким же образом добавляем вторую кнопку.

    3. Теперь нам нужно сделать само содержание страниц. start-game.html уже существует, просто редактируем его под себя. А для второй страницы создаем файл info.html и вставляем в него следующее:
    Код:
    <div class="form-block">
    <div class="bloack-header">Название страницы:</div>
    <div class="block-line"></div>
    <div class="tab-pane" id="Launcer">
    Текст страницы! 
    </div>
    </div>
    Как сделать текст красивым, ищем сами в учебниках html.

    4. Кнопки для пользователей не прошедших авторизацию мы уже сделали, осталось дело за малым. Редактируем menu.html примерно так:
    Код:
    <li id="menu-main-btn"><a href="index.php">Главная</a></li>
    <li id="menu-start-btn"><a href="index.php?mode=100">Начать играть</a></li>
    <li id="menu-info-btn"><a href="index.php?mode=101">Информация</a></li>
    <?php echo $addition; ?>
    <li id="menu-options-btn"><a href="index.php?mode=2">Настройки</a></li>
    <li id="menu-exit-btn"><a href="login.php?out=1">Выход</a></li>
    Вот в принципе и все. Писал ночью, мог допустить ошибки и забыть что нибудь написать.
    [​IMG]
    [​IMG]
    [​IMG]
     
  11. Vampikkkk

    Vampikkkk Старожил Пользователь

    Баллы:
    173
    Skype:
    Vampikkkk
    @PacMyc,у вас нет урока случайно как настроить мониторинг? ато пытался, пытался в итоге вырезал
     
    Пароль123456789 нравится это.
  12. PacMyc

    PacMyc Активный участник Пользователь

    Баллы:
    68
    Skype:
    pacmyc.ru
    До мониторинга я еще не дошел. Он у меня тоже работает на половину. Вообще я думаю использовать другой мониторинг. Если завтра найду время, то постараюсь разобраться и выложить.
     
    Vedroyder и Vampikkkk нравится это.
  13. Vampikkkk

    Vampikkkk Старожил Пользователь

    Баллы:
    173
    Skype:
    Vampikkkk
    @PacMyc,буду ждать вышей темы:)
     
    Сникерсни нравится это.
  14. PohmeloO

    PohmeloO Активный участник

    Баллы:
    68
    Имя в Minecraft:
    PohmeloO
    @PacMyc, хороший урок. Лайканул.:)


    @Vampikkkk и @PacMyc, могу поделиться с вами мониторингом сайта Ensemplix. Мне не жалко за мониторингом в лс.
     
  15.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
    Да робит там мониторинг хост нормальный нужен и все!
     
  16. PohmeloO

    PohmeloO Активный участник

    Баллы:
    68
    Имя в Minecraft:
    PohmeloO
    @alexandrage, у кого то нету возможности купить норм хост поэтому мы и пытаемся помоч им сделать все на бесплатном...
     
  17.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
    На бесплатном робит все кроме монитора, разве что чем то ивзне отправлять на скрипт инфу!
     
  18. alexandrage

    alexandrage Администратор

    Баллы:
    173
    Skype:
    alexandr0116
    Или мониторить на денвере и вставить через iframe как то так :) .
     
  19. Alastar

    Alastar Старожил Пользователь

    Баллы:
    173
    Но наверстать то каждый может:trf:
    P.S. Видели бы вы что я сделал с Webmcr 18 :trf:
     
    ВремяПриключений нравится это.
  20. PohmeloO

    PohmeloO Активный участник

    Баллы:
    68
    Имя в Minecraft:
    PohmeloO
    Н==
    Может каждый! А я показывал с чего начать новичку.
     
  21. Alastar

    Alastar Старожил Пользователь

    Баллы:
    173
    Если честно, я с нуля научился верстать дизайн именно на этом лк))
     

Поделиться этой страницей